Btw, the issue with x86's lesser precision in FP is based on very dated information.  It may be true or it may be untrue,  So it may not be relevant anymore.  An interesting note that DF brought up is the fact the x86 actually does 80-bit Extended Precision on 64 bit computation.  this extension on precision is done internally.

Of course what BadAndy is referning to are trigonomic functions.  I have no idea how that is handled in hardware on the x86, it might still be true today but for regular FP ADD, MUL, DIV, SUB, and SQRT it's true to say that this extended precision gives it better accuracy, unless there is some sort of hardware bug.
